Default UKIP relies on Tory votes and support of ex-Conservatives

But presumably you want the votes of the 1.2 million Conservatives who voted UKIP in the last EU Election? Of course, you may not want those votes - in which case, if those Conservative votes are lost and UKIP has to rely on the votes of Labour and Campbell's Fib Dims in the next EU Election (2009) the party (UKIP) would probably fall to about 2 seats (not the original 12 EU seats won by UKIP in June 2004).

As for Tories (Conservatives) in UKIP. There are people in UKIP who were once voters or supporters of the Conservative Party. Their party is now UKIP and their loyalty with UKIP. I'm sure it's the same in the Green Party. There must be quite a few ex-Labour and ex-Liberal 'Democrat' people now Green Party members (I know of one former anti-EU Conservative who is now a Green Party member). But I'm sure the Green Party are not going to ask them to leave the party. If it did their membership numbers would fall by at least 75%.
